How to repot a cactusCactus is a plant that needs to be repotted once a year, because it grows rapidly during the growth period and needs a lot of nutrients to continue growing, so as to ensure the supply of nutrients needed for its growth. 1. Watering treatmentWatering should be stopped one week before repotting to allow the soil in the pot to be completely dry, making it easier to repot without damaging the roots and plants. 2. NotesBefore repotting, be careful to avoid pricking your hands, so wear thick gloves to prevent pricking your hands. 3. RepottingThen you can tap the wall of the pot a few times to loosen the soil between the potting soil and the potting wall. This will help the entire sphere to separate from the pot without harming the plant. 4. Preparation for repottingYou need to clean up the old soil and you can also slightly prune the strong roots to keep the plant in beautiful shape and help it receive light. However, you do not need to prune the weak plants and you can plant them directly in new potting soil. 5. Tips for changing potsAfter preparing the replacement potting soil, you can fix the plant at an appropriate height and then pour it into the potting soil. Be careful to bury it shallowly and not too deep, which will be detrimental to root growth. 6. Maintenance after repottingYou need to compact the soil in the pot slightly, and just ensure normal drainage. After changing the pot, you can place the newly potted cactus in a place with bright light and good air circulation for maintenance. Do not water it after that. Wait for it to grow new thorns, which means the repotting is successful. After about a week, you can water it normally, but don't water it too much to avoid root rot.
